Yes, that's correct! When you have the expression \(10^2 \times 10^3\), you can combine the exponents by adding them, according to the rules of exponents.
So:
\[
10^2 \times 10^3 = 10^{2+3} = 10^5
\]
Now, when you calculate \(10^5\):
\[
10^5 = 100,000
\]
So, both \(10^5\) and \(100,000\) represent the same numerical value.
